I make that 37 new Managers appointed since the end of last season - and we are still in November. Only six Managers have been in their jobs for more than five years and just 15 have been in situ for more than three years - one of those is Karl Robinson at Oxford and another is Matt Taylor at Exeter who continues to do a fantastic job. Yesterday's defeat was only Exeter's second in all competitions and they currently sit in 2nd in League 2.1
